## Changelog — Twigreaper v2.1

Defaults changed: stale threshold dropped from 90 to 45 days, and protected-branch matching now includes release/* by default. Deletions are dry-run for the first 24 hours after upgrade. If paged about unexpected branch removals, check the audit log first. Current effective defaults follow below.

deployment values, kajep-kageg:
[praix]
host = praix.paliqcorp.corp
user = praix_svc
database = praix_prod

The roof-terrace door at Pennard Court has a known fault: the latch mechanism swells in damp weather and the door jams shut. Contractors should never force it, as this damages the strike plate. Instead, push firmly at the top corner while turning the handle fully. If it remains stuck, use the secondary stairwell door, which accepts the access code below.

turnstile pass: bdg-MWRUHE-76377440

**Ticket: Seat-map renderer misaligns boxes at the Fennwick Playhouse layout**

The Orchestra-level seat map in Stagewright renders box seats two rows off after the latest viewport change, causing incorrect holds. Fix is staged behind a flag; needs verification against the Fennwick and Larch Hall layouts before merge. This requires explicit sign-off, and the approver of record is listed below.

approver of yawig-yajef = Briius Jorix

## Releases

Hey support folks — quick notes on ProfileMesh shard releases. Each release re-balances user-profile shards gradually, so don't panic if a lookup lands on a stale shard for a few minutes post-deploy; it self-heals. Release bundles are published twice a month and are always signed. If a customer asks you to verify a bundle they downloaded, walk them through the checksum step using the public signing key below.

deploy key for kawif-bageg: bky19_YQNdHDgpaLxUNwPoHm9

Hey — welcome aboard. Quick brain dump on the Fernhollow greenhouse controller before I head out. The humidity sensors in bays 3 and 5 drift upward after about two weeks of continuous operation, so the controller applies a rolling recalibration offset rather than trusting raw readings. Marta tuned the correction window last spring and it's been stable since, so please don't "simplify" it. If plants start wilting near the east wall, check drift compensation first. The controller currently runs with these values.

settings of tawig-hawef:
[zorath]
port = 7000
region = north-1
host = zorath.tolvaqworks.corp
timeout_ms = 1000
retries = 1